Section 3: Budget Financial Statements


The budget financial statements will form the basis of the financial statements that will appear in the Australian Taxation Office 1999-2000 Annual Report, and form the basis for the input into the Whole of Government Accounts.

Budget Statement of Revenues and Expenses (Budget Operating Statement)

This statement provides a picture of the expected financial results for the ATO by identifying full accrual expenses and revenues, which highlights whether the ATO is operating at a sustainable level.

Budget Statement of Assets and Liabilities (Budget Balance Sheet)

This statement shows the financial position of the ATO. It enables decision makers to track the management of the ATO's assets and liabilities.

Budget Cash Flow Statement

This statement identifies expected cash flows from operating activities, investing activities and financing activities.

Capital Budget

This statement shows all proposed capital expenditure funded either through the Budget as appropriations or from internal sources.

Non-financial Assets -- Summary of Movement

This statement shows the movement in the ATO's non-financial assets over the Budget year 1999-2000.

NOTES TO THE FINANCIAL STATEMENTS

Notes to the Agency Statements

Details of Agency items in the financial statements included in Table 3.1 to 3.5 have been prepared in accordance with Schedule 2 of the Finance Minister's Orders for 1997-98.

The budget statements and estimated forward years have been prepared to reflect the following matters.

Change in Administrative Arrangements

During 1998-99 administration of the Child Support Agency moved from the ATO to the Department of Family and Community Affairs. Administrative responsibility for the collection of Excise moved from Customs and Excise to the ATO.

Cost of Administering Goods and Services Tax

Agency statements for 1999-2000 and forward years include the estimated costs of administering the proposed Goods and Services Tax on behalf of the States and Territories of Australia.

Costs of Administering Other Tax Reform Proposals

Agency statements for 1999-2000 and forward years include a cost estimated for taxation reform proposals announced by the Government as part of A New Tax System or expected to result from the Government's response to the first recommendations made by the Review of Business Taxation.

Loss on Sale of Assets

Agency statements for 1998-99 include an estimated loss on sale of non-current assets of $38.343 million. This loss was incurred on the sale of assets purchased by the selected tenderer as part of the outsourcing arrangements for the ATO computer systems and services.

Goods and Services Tax

Administered statements for 2000-01 and estimated forward years do not include as revenue the estimated receipts of the proposed Goods and Service Tax (GST). The gross receipts for this tax are not considered to be revenue of the Commonwealth for budgetary purposes.

Ancillary impacts of the GST on the operating statements and balance sheets have also been excluded from the administered statements except for the recognition of the proposed cost of administration of the tax to be recovered from the revenue otherwise due to the States and Territories.

Change in Administered Arrangements

An amount of $284.672 million, representing the balance of receivables due for Excise revenue as at the date of change of administered arrangements, has been brought to account as an extraordinary item for the 1998-99 financial year.
